Maintaining Ideal Humidity Levels

Achieving consistent property well-being frequently relies on thoroughly managing humidity. Too much humidity can foster mildew development and create a unpleasant feeling, while too low humidity often leads to arid complexion and inflamed breathing systems. The suggested range is generally between 30% and 50%, but this may vary according to personal preferences and the region. Employing a humidity control device during damp seasons, or a moisture adding device in parched conditions, can successfully tackle these problems. Regularly checking humidity with a hygrometer is essential for early humidity regulation.

Grasping Relative Dampness: A Practical Guide

Relative moisture is a idea that often gets tossed around, but what does it actually imply? It doesn't measure the quantity of water in click to read the air directly, but rather the proportion of water vapor present compared to the maximum amount the air could hold at a given warmth. Think of it this way: warmer air can hold more water vapor than cooler air. Consequently, a relatively low relative moisture on a warm day might still feel quite oppressive, while a higher reading on a cold day could feel rather dry. Tracking relative humidity is crucial for everything from preserving fragile materials to ensuring best ease in your dwelling. You can easily measure it with a humidity meter, accessible at most home improvement stores.
